Overall a good experience (except one thing - see in the bottom). The location is somewhat central and on the walking promenade, but not very close to the railway station or the waterfront. About 25-35 min walk to the railway station but still okay. About 15 min to the waterfront.
Food options: there are a couple of local restaurants right near across from the promenade, including a noodle shop, a tempura donburi and a fried seafood place - all along the promenade. There's also a PX Mart not too far away, about 5 min walk.
The rooms are spacious and clean, very new renovation (as of 2025, seems like 2023-2024), no fridge in the room (on the first floor only), but there's a kettle. The bed was somewhat stiff but okay.
Overall felt like great value for the location and the quality, and especially the room size.
The only drawback - Easy to fix - was the towels. There was no proper size bathroom towels on my stay in May 2025. The small towels are rather insuficcient for showering.

It's clean, it's close to the train station, where you can rent a scooter to explore Taroko National Park, also have a gas station next door to refill your scooter and you are next to the main road to go to the National Park. There is enough stuff to cook yourself something. Communication with the landlord on self check-in went well and I could check-in earlier because my bed was free, actually I was the only guest in the dorm on my first of two nights.
It was calm and the entire hostel & bathroom was very clean. I liked, that you can buy razors, one-way towels, toothbrush kit for a small fee, even if I didn't need it.
The only downside, and that's why I gave it -3 stars in amenity was, that the mattress was so hard, it felt like sleeping on the floor. The room had a bit of strange moisture smell, but I could get used to it quickly. If there would be a thicker, less hard mattress, that place would get total points.
